The Agent shall retain as compensation for issuing each of the
above licenses, the sum of Twenty-five Cents (25c) the balance of
said fee to be paid and accounted for as prescribed by law in this
Article, and the Agent shall deliver the license properly executed
to the applicant in person or by mail without further cost; said
licensee shall insert his or her name on the license in ink at the
time of purchase. Such license shall not be transferable and if used
or presented by any person other than the person to whom it was
issued, such license shall be confiscated by the Director, any Game
Warden, Constable or other officer who shall find such license being
used.
The penalty for any non-resident of the State of Maryland found
guilty of hunting on a Regulated Pheasant Shooting Area without
having first procured a license, or for refusing to show said license
when demanded by the Director, or any Game Warden, Sheriff,
Constable or other officer, or person, or failing to display the license
tag on his back as provided by law shall be the same as those
penalties set forth in Section 129.
Nothing herein contained shall prevent the holders of a Regular
Non-Resident Hunting license from hunting on Regulated Pheasant
Shooting Grounds by requiring them to obtain an additional license
as prescribed herein.
SEC. 2. And be it further enacted, That this Act shall take effect
June 1, 1955.
Approved March 24,1955.
CHAPTER 122
(House Bill 216)
AN ACT to repeal and re-enact, with amendments, Section 98 of
Article 1 of the Code of Public Local Laws of Maryland (1930
Edition), title "Allegany County," sub-title "County Commission-
ers," as amended by Chapter 272 of the Acts of 1951, permitting
the County Commissioners of Allegany County to pay a sum of
money to the Allegany-Garrett Tuberculosis Association.
SECTION 1. Be it enacted by the General Assembly of Maryland,
That Section 98 of Article 1 of the Code of Public Local Laws of
Maryland (1930 Edition), title "Allegany County/' sub-title "County
Commissioners/' as amended by Chapter 272 of the Acts of 1951, be
and it is hereby repealed and re-enacted, with amendments, to read
as follows:
